Output 3dd223a20bdb7995523d9826d0462771a8da9fd4078019f8c67cf0b0a9e43e02:0

value
101608
script pubkey
OP_0 OP_PUSHBYTES_20 be1a2d8faf4a99098ea9a3cc6d987b2acbe358e5
address
bc1qhcdzmra0f2vsnr4f50xxmxrm9t97xk893px5x9
transaction
3dd223a20bdb7995523d9826d0462771a8da9fd4078019f8c67cf0b0a9e43e02
spent
true